Who Benefits?

The money will go to Shelterbox - an amazing charity that provides boxes containing the basic requirements of shelter, warmth and self-sufficiency, that are deployed in emergency situations.  It is an incredibly simple idea that is also extremely effective.

Each box costs £490.
